How Balance: Meditation & Sleep Advertises on Meta
Updated Apr 19, 2026 · Refreshes weekly
Balance: Meditation & Sleep runs 20 active ads on Meta, shipping ~3 new creatives per week. Their library leans on Listicle17%, Statistic13%, and Letter13%. Recently, Balance leans hard on the "mindful morning routine" angle, positioning the app as the antidote to anxious, chaotic starts to the day. Personalization, free access, and quick-hit sessions (like a 10-minute gratitude meditation) are the consistent hooks used to lower the barrier to entry.
